L-Isoleucine is a metabolite found in or produced by Saccharomyces cerevisiae.

  • CIR ingredient: Isoleucine
  • An essential amino acid; [Merck Index] An isomer of leucine found in many proteins; [ChemIDplus] Used as a flavoring agent and nutritional supplement for foods; [FDA] Used a nutritional supplement and for biochemical research; [HSDB]
  • Isoleucine is an essential amino acid; [Merck Index] Used as a flavoring agent; [FDA] Used in animal feeds; [ExPub: EFSA]

Physical DescriptionDry Powder
Color/FormWaxy, shiny, rhombic leaflets from alcohol
Melting Point284 °C (decomposes)
Boiling PointSublimes at 168-170 °C
SolubilityGlistening rhombic or monoclinic plates from dilute alcohol. Decomposes at 292 °C. pK1 = 2.32; pK2 = 9.76. Solubility in water (g/L): 18.3 at 0 °C; 22.3 at 25 °C; 30.3 at 50 °C; 46.1 at 75 °C; 78.0…
Vapor Pressure0.00000001 [mmHg]
IUPAC Name(2S,3S)-2-amino-3-methylpentanoic acid
Molecular FormulaC6H13NO2
Molecular Weight131.17 g/mol
CAS73-32-5
SMILESCC[C@H](C)[C@@H](C(=O)O)N
InChIKeyAGPKZVBTJJNPAG-WHFBIAKZSA-N
